​​​​​​​Here is what you will need:

  • Maryland State License
  • Current ARRT in Mammography certification or eligible to take advanced level exam with documentation of clinical experience.
  • Completion of a two-year approved School of Radiologic Technology
  • Continuing Education: MQSA/FDA- 15 CEU’s every 3 years, 200-documented case numbers every 2 years.
  • Experience with diagnostic procedures such as ultrasound core and stereotactic biopsies is preferred.

 

A Day in the Life of a Mammography Technologist:

  • Provide services and support for the following areas:
    • Prepares for and assists the Radiologist in the completion of intricate mammography examinations, including breast biopsies.
    • Produce high-quality films for the radiologist to evaluate.
    • Effectively communicate to patients the procedures and educate women about the role of regular mammography in preventative breast health.
    • Maintain patient-first focus at all times and exhibit outstanding customer service skills.
    • Ability to effectively communicate on an individual and small group basis to doctors, patients, and other employees.
    • Consistently practice excellent mammography positioning and exposure technique.
    • Complete appropriate documentation.
    • Perform quality control functions related to mammography.
    • Assist in the compilation and maintenance of statistical data.
    • Promote privacy and comfort for the patient.
